...A STRONG THUNDERSTORM WILL IMPACT NORTHEASTERN GREENVILLE COUNTY
THROUGH 700 PM EDT...

At 626 PM EDT, Doppler radar was tracking a strong thunderstorm 14
miles southeast of Brevard, or near Jones Gap State Park, moving
southeast at 25 mph.

HAZARD...Wind gusts up to 50 mph and pea size hail.

SOURCE...Radar indicated.

IMPACT...Gusty winds could knock down tree limbs and blow around
         unsecured objects. Minor hail damage to outdoor objects is
         possible.

Locations impacted include...
Slater-Marietta, Tigerville, Pleasant Ridge State Park, Travelers
Rest, and Cleveland.

P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S...

If outdoors, consider seeking shelter inside a building.
